PlusAI is transforming transportation with Physical AI, developing SuperDrive™ virtual driver software for factory-built autonomous commercial vehicles and HyperFoundry™ AI data platform.

As a Field Service Engineer, you will leverage your experience and knowledge to help continue building the Field Engineering team’s processes and procedures that integrate and maintain Plus’s autonomous vehicle technology on internal and customer vehicles. The role supports autonomous vehicle testing and deployment with a comprehensive focus on remote monitoring, real-time intervention, and data logging. You will provide hands-on vehicle readiness for complex demo drives and fleet maintenance activities. Specifically, you will support testing by riding in the vehicle to actively monitor system performance and sensor health, execute live testing and mileage accumulation, rapidly troubleshoot issues that arise in the field, and document all findings through daily reports and actionable engineering tickets for cross-functional teams.

Responsibilities:

  • Support autonomous vehicle testing by operating and riding in Class 8 (semi-trucks) or equivalent vehicles to actively monitor system performance, execute live testing, and accumulate mileage.
  • Provide hands-on vehicle readiness for complex demonstrations and fleet maintenance activities, ensuring all systems and sensors are operational.
  • Work onsite during system installation and field deployment Act as the main point of contact for third-party installers and customers/end-users.
  • Willingness and ability to travel more than 60%, including weekends, as required to support field operations.
  • Rapidly troubleshoot and resolve novel or complex technical issues impacting autonomous vehicle systems, including hardware, software, and electrical subsystems.
  • Analyze data from engineering drawings, databases, and field actions to consolidate and escalate reliability issues to the engineering team in a concise and actionable manner.
  • Collaborate with engineering to develop and document real-time mitigation actions, long-term containment options, and corrective/preventative measures.
  • Meticulously document all troubleshooting and return-to-service actions, including findings from daily reports and testing, by creating and updating actionable engineering tickets.
  • Create and maintain standardized installation and repair documentation (SOPs), focusing on making all programming, calibration, and testing procedures reliable and repeatable for service partners and technicians.
  • Interpret engineering changes (e.g., deviations, change orders) and create clear, comprehensive procedures for implementing these changes in field environments such as warehouses, repair shops, and customer locations.

Required Skills:

  • BS or MS in a STEM-related field (e.g., Engineering, Computer Science, etc.), or equivalent combination of education and work experience.
  • Relevant work experience involving analysis, engineering, or technical system testing, preferably within the automotive or autonomous vehicle industry.
  • Strong technical proficiency with Linux command line and experience using software version control systems (e.g., GIT).
  • Familiarity with containerization (Docker), scripting languages (Python, Bash), and automotive software-based diagnostic systems.
  • Experience with collaboration tools such as Google Workspace and Atlassian (Jira/Confluence).
  • Demonstrated ability to collect, organize, analyze, and disseminate significant amounts of information with meticulous attention to detail and accuracy.
  • Ability to work as a self-starter in a rapidly changing, fast-paced environment and take on increased responsibility.
  • Must be capable of safely lifting up to 80+ lbs and repeatedly entering/exiting vehicles as large as Class 8 (semi-trucks).
  • Valid driver's license with a clean driving record and the ability to rent a car for business travel.
